Description
The Chowan Hawks are the athletic teams that represent Chowan University, located in Murfreesboro, North Carolina, in NCAA Division II intercollegiate sports.
Background
Founded:
1910
Location:
Murfreesboro, North Carolina, USA
Abbreviation:
Hawks
President:
0 reviews
Be the first one to write a review for Chowan University Men’s Soccer (Chowan Hawks).